I disagree that pressure/wind relationship is a myth. Rapidly circulating winds reduce the pressure inside - the faster the winds, the more the reduction... but... and this is important to note: the spread of the eye can also affect the other two readings. The tighter the eye, the closer the relationship agreement between pressure and wind speed (approximates a tornado). Katrina and Rita both have large eyes and the relationship evidently begins to break down.
